Beltangady: A macabre road accident involving a mini passenger tempo and an autorickshaw near Laila bridge here on October 20, Sunday, left four persons including a child dead and six others with serious injuries.

Eyewitnesses said the Ape Autorickshaw tried to overtake a lorry and in the process  hit against the tempo.All those killed were travelling in the autorickshaw. The deceased are Hassainar (40), Mohammed Irfan (2), Zainabi (30) and Nasir (13). If two of them died on the spot, two others passed away in the hospital.

The injured have been identified as  Nafisa (55), Zohra (40), Mariamma (35), Dilshad (12) and Sharief (24), the autorickshaw driver. The tempo driver Chethan was lucky enough and escaped with minor injuries. All the injured hailed from Mundur and were on way home after attending a function at Kajoor.

The mini tempo was carrying pilgrims from Chikmagalur who  were  heading towards Dharmasthala after visiting Kateel, Udupi, Kollur and other pilgrim places.

Both the tempo and the autorickshaw were badly mangled in the mishap which disrupted traffic for  over an hour.
Belthangady police have registered a case.
